  What is a Dental Implant? Dental implants are artificial tooth roots made of biocompatible materials, typically titanium, that are surgically placed into the jawbone to provide a sturdy foundation for replacement teeth. They are a permanent and effective solution for replacing missing teeth, offering numerous benefits over traditional dentures or bridges. Who are Candidates for Dental Implants? Candidates for dental implants are individuals who have one or more missing teeth and are in good overall oral health. Adequate jawbone density and healthy gums are important factors for the success of dental implant surgery. Your dentist or oral surgeon will evaluate your specific situation to determine if dental implants are suitable for you. What is bonding? Dental bonding  has been utilized in dentistry for many years as a low-cost and straightforward technique to change the appearance of your smile. Its primary advantages are that it is non-invasive and that it may fix flaws ranging from tooth discoloration to gaps and spacing.  Dental bonding  is an excellent approach to repair a minor chip in a tooth or to heal tooth decay in a cosmetic region.
